The ETF known as Jacobi FT Wilshere Bitcoin ETF, overseen by the Guernsey Financial Services Commission (GFSC), will be active with the trading symbol "BCOIN." Fidelity Digital Assets is responsible for safeguarding the fund's assets, and Jacobi has verified that Flow Traders, a trading company, will serve as the market maker.

I also don't like them, but maybe I can answer your question.
People who invest in bitcoin ETF are people who usually don't do anything themselves. In case of individuals, those are people who don't manage their own wealth, but have managers to do it for them. Have you seen the movie about Madoff? He'd call people and get them to wire money to his fund just like that.
-Hey man, there's an opportunity to make big money, but I need 10 million
-Sure, I'll send it to you later. What's the profit? 15%? Not bad.

These fund managers don't want to hold bitcoin for their clients and they know exchanges don't offer insurance, so they need a big fund to tell them it's safe to buy. If someone trusted were to offer trading and custodial services with insurance that the coins are going to be there a year later, they'd buy.
Another typical client of these ETFs are companies, where the board cannot simply say that the CEO will now hold 5% of the company's funds on his personal laptop. What if he dies? Who's going to have passwords? So the obvious route is to have a trusted third party to hold it for them. At least if things go wrong they'll have someone to blame and sue for the loss.

This ETF is registered in the Channel Islands, which is, of course, outside the EU and sort of outside the UK as well. It is on Euronext Amsterdam, with the current price of $18, but I'm still not convinced how big of news that actually is. I mean, the registration isn't in the EU, there's no info about legislative approval of financial regulators in the EU, and it's just de facto listed on Euronext stock exchange.
In any case, the buzz about the difficulty of an ETF approval was all about the SEC in the US, not about the EU or something that isn't even registered in the EU.
I'm happy they achieved something, but it seems that this achievement might be overestimated.
